Sail Date: Dec 2016
Cabin: Central Park View Stateroom

I chose this cruise because of the size of the ship and the ads about the neighborhoods.. I also chose it because of the advertisements about all the activities. The ship was beautiful and there was a a lot to see and do. It was not as advertised, not worth the hype. I had a Central park view and immediately regretted it. I wish I had booked and ocean view. You can't really tell you are on a ship and loose the cruise effect. Although the staterooms are average the shower is so small that it makes you feel uncomfortable. I saw numerous people that could not fit into them at all.

My feeling for the ship was that they spent most of the entire time trying to sell you something especially internet access, spa services and drink packages. The meals in the windjammer,cafe p, solarium and wipe out cafe was good, in spite of so much repetition at each meal. We had dinner in one specialty restaurant the 360 cafe and boy was that a mistake, I wish I could have chosen another one. but at $90.00 for the meal w didn't want to try another. I had sailed RC before and enjoyed the cruise on the Majesty of the Seas.

This cruise seemed to be more about making money and the outrageous prices for the drink packages. To drink enough to cover the cost would surely ruin your kidneys. I do not think I will book another Royal Caribbean cruise and would not recommend it to anyone.
